Ah...my first journey to Japan. I've always wanted to experience Tokyo and so I made sure to explore the city as much as possible. I felt it would be better to save other locations like Kyoto or Okinawa for another trip. As the trip approached I started to realize more and more how massive Tokyo is; people told me beforehand "you only need a couple days in Tokyo, you should check out other places" -- that's not true, you could easily spend a few weeks just exploring Tokyo. I definitely made the right decision. I stayed at a new Tokyu Stay hotel in Ginza which was great because it was near the Higashi-Ginza line, making it relatively easy to get around. In hindsight I would have chosen to stay in Shibuya just for the nightlife opportunities.
Places I visited in Tokyo include Akihabara, Asakusa, Shinjuku, Harajuku, Hibiya, Shibuya (Famous Hachiko Crossing!), Kabuki, Ikebukouro, Oshiage(Sky Tree!), Daiba (Gundam!), Urayasu (Tokyo Disney Sea!), the infamous Tsukiji (Fish Market!), and many other places I can't remember between stops.
